BSPP vs BSPT: why a parallel thread needs a seal and a tapered one does not

They share a thread form and a size designation, and they do not seal the same way. How to tell them apart on the bench, and what happens when they are mixed.

Two fittings marked 1/2 BSP, from the same drawer, that will not do the same job. The designation refers to the thread size only — it says nothing about whether the thread is parallel or tapered, and that is the property which decides how the joint seals.

/01

The same thread, cut two ways.

Both are Whitworth-form threads with a 55° included angle and the same threads-per-inch for a given size. Put a pitch gauge on them and you get the same reading. The difference is that BSPP is cut parallel along its length and BSPT is cut on a taper, so a BSPT thread grows in diameter from the leading thread backwards.

ISO 228-1ISO

Pipe threads where pressure-tight joints are not made on the threads — Part 1: Dimensions, tolerances and designation

The title carries the whole argument. This is the parallel-thread standard, and it states in its own name that the joint is not sealed by the threads — which is precisely why a BSPP connection needs a cone seat or a bonded washer to function at all.

ISO 7-1ISO

Pipe threads where pressure-tight joints are made on the threads — Part 1: Dimensions, tolerances and designation

The tapered counterpart, and note the inverted title. Here the threads do make the joint, with a sealant, which is what limits how many times a BSPT connection can be broken and re-made before it stops sealing.

Telling them apart.

How do you tell BSPP from BSPT?

Measure across the thread crests at the first thread and again at the last. A parallel thread reads the same at both ends; a tapered one grows measurably along its length. On a female port, look for a cone seat — a 60° seat means the port is designed for a parallel male.

On smaller sizes the taper is easy to miss by eye, which is how the substitution happens. A caliper settles it in seconds. On a female port the giveaway is the seat: a machined cone means the port expects a parallel male and a cone-seated fitting to seal against it.

Common questions

Is "G" thread the same as BSPP?

Yes. The G designation from ISO 228-1 is the parallel thread. "R" is the tapered external thread and "Rc" the tapered internal one under ISO 7-1.

Can I use PTFE tape on a BSPP joint?

It will not do what you want. The seal on a parallel joint is the cone or the bonded washer; tape on the threads adds nothing and can hold the fitting off its seat. If a BSPP joint leaks, look at the seat and the washer.

How many times can a BSPT joint be re-made?

Fewer than people assume. Each make deforms the mating threads slightly, so sealing degrades with every break. If a tapered joint has been disturbed several times and still weeps, replace the fitting rather than adding sealant.

Is BSP the same as NPT?

No, and this is the more damaging mix-up. BSP is a 55° thread form and NPT is 60°, so the flanks never mate properly even when the sizes appear compatible. They will start together and the joint will leak.
